Day 1: Arrival and Exploring Gangtok

Gangtok, Sikkim, India on April 20, 2025

8:00am

Breakfast at Baker's Cafe

Enjoy a hearty breakfast with a blend of Indian and Continental cuisine at this popular cafe located in the heart of Gangtok. The ambience and quality will energize you for the day.
INR500, 1h

9:30am

Enchey Monastery Visit

Visit this peaceful 200-year-old Buddhist monastery known for its architecture and spiritual aura. It offers insights into Buddhist rituals and lovely views of the surrounding valley.
INR20, 1h

11:00am

Namgyal Institute of Tibetology

Explore this renowned research centre that houses a remarkable collection of Tibetan artefacts, manuscripts, and Thangka paintings, essential to understanding the cultural history of Sikkim.
INR100, 1h30m

1:00pm

Lunch at Taste of Tibet

Savour authentic Tibetan cuisine including momo dumplings and thukpa noodles at this well-reviewed local restaurant in Gangtok.
INR350, 1h

2:30pm

MG Road Leisure Walk

Stroll along MG Road, Gangtok’s bustling main street lined with shops, cafes and street food vendors. This pedestrian-friendly mall closes around 9pm offering an energetic yet relaxed atmosphere.
Free, 2h

5:00pm

Visit Ganesh Tok and Hanuman Tok

Visit these two popular hilltop temples offering panoramic views of Gangtok town and the Himalayan peaks. Ideal for sunset viewing and photography.
Free, 1h30m

7:00pm

Dinner at The Coffee Shop

Enjoy a diverse menu featuring local Sikkimese dishes and continental fare in a cosy environment, perfect after a day of sightseeing.
INR450, 1h30m

Day 2: Lakes and Mountain Pass

Gangtok, Sikkim, India on April 21, 2025

7:00am

Early Breakfast at Hotel

Start your day with a nutritious breakfast at your hotel to prepare for a day of excursions to high-altitude locations.
Typically included, 45m

8:00am

Tsongmo Lake (Changu Lake)

Visit this stunning glacial lake at 3,780m surrounded by snow-capped mountains. It is sacred and peaceful, perfect for photos and light walks around the lake.
INR50, 2h

11:00am

Visit Nathula Pass

Explore the historic Nathula Pass on the India-China border, open from 9am to 4pm on Thursdays to Sundays. Experience spectacular vistas and understand its strategic importance.
INR600, 2h

1:30pm

Lunch at Local Wayside Dhaba

Enjoy freshly prepared local food at a wayside dhaba en route back, serving hearty dishes like thukpa and momos.
INR200, 1h

3:30pm

Return to Gangtok and Rest

After the adventure, rest at your hotel or explore local markets at your leisure.
Free, Rest of day

7:00pm

Dinner at The Square

Dine at this elegant restaurant located in the Elgin Hotel serving a refined mix of Indian and Continental dishes with excellent ambience.
INR600, 1h30m

Day 3: Scenic Pelling Excursion

Pelling, Sikkim, India on April 22, 2025

7:00am

Breakfast at Hotel in Gangtok

Fuel up for a journey to Pelling with a nourishing breakfast at your hotel before departure.
Typically included, 45m

8:30am

Drive to Pelling

Enjoy a 4-hour scenic drive to Pelling, taking in views of rice terraces and mountainous terrain while crossing through quaint villages.
INR1500 (taxi or private car), 4h

1:00pm

Lunch at a Local Restaurant in Pelling

Have authentic Sikkimese cuisine such as gundruk soup at a popular local eatery in Pelling.
INR350, 1h

2:30pm

Visit Pemayangtse Monastery

Tour one of the oldest and most important Buddhist monasteries in Sikkim established in the early 1700s. Its serene surroundings and intricate artwork are culturally enriching.
INR50, 1h

4:00pm

Rabdentse Ruins

Explore the ruins of the ancient capital of Sikkim overlooking the Kanchenjunga range, a site full of history and beautiful vista points.
INR50, 1h

6:00pm

Check-in and Dinner at a Pelling Resort

Relax and dine at your resort enjoying views of the mountains and regional cuisine specialties.
INR700, 1h30m

Day 4: Namchi and Tea Gardens

Namchi, Sikkim, India on April 23, 2025

7:30am

Breakfast at Hotel in Pelling

Enjoy a fresh breakfast with Himalayan views, preparing for a day of exploration in Namchi.
Typically included, 45m

9:00am

Drive to Namchi

Drive approximately 2.5 hours to Namchi, enjoying the lush landscapes of southern Sikkim en route.
INR1200 (taxi/private car), 2h30m

11:45am

Visit Namchi Char Dham

Explore this famous religious site comprising replicas of four Hindu dhams with breathtaking architecture and panoramic views of the valleys.
INR20, 1h

1:00pm

Lunch at Taste Of Namchi Restaurant

Sample local dishes influenced by Nepali and Indian cooking in a casual atmosphere.
INR300, 1h

2:30pm

Visit Temi Tea Garden

Tour Sikkim’s only tea estate, walk through lush tea plantations and learn about tea processing. Open until 5pm, it offers scenic photo opportunities.
Free, 2h

5:30pm

Return to Gangtok

Drive back to Gangtok (approx. 3h) for overnight stay.
INR1500, 3h

8:30pm

Dinner at Hotel Restaurant, Gangtok

Relax with a quiet dinner at your hotel, enjoying local Sikkimese or Indian cuisine after the long day.
INR500, 1h
